This combeite with wollastonite, nepheline, augite matrix was collected in an ejected boulder field in the African Rift Valley, Tanzania. This remote region is home to the Oldoinyo Lengai Volcano, translated from the Maasai language - the "Mountain of God." This region is known for unique low-temperature carbonatitic lava.

Combeite is a rare silicate mineral. It is named after Arthur Delmar Combe, a geologist with the Geological Survey of Uganda, who contributed to our knowledge of the geology of the Virunga volcanic field.

This material came from the Lava eruption of 1917, and this rare Na-Ca-Silicate forms colorless long prismatic, striated crystals about 4mm in size. The material is enclosed in a lava matrix.
